Output fd221ec0e8156ddae2a66f1a298d64016a2fd708f85c9486739180d8cb2fe922:0

value
999486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e6cac8caf269a9cd59d43c3b07a5de4845a81f2 OP_EQUAL
address
34TtP6sc4WYmRuMkLscJbh972PGgVqLxi7
transaction
fd221ec0e8156ddae2a66f1a298d64016a2fd708f85c9486739180d8cb2fe922
spent
true